Подключите нашего Telegram-бота для уведомлений о новых проектах

Сервис по работе с задачами

D
Заказчик
Отзывы фрилансеров: + 0 - 0
Зарегистрирован на сайте 14 лет и 4 месяца
Бюджет: по договоренности
Исполнитель определен: Сергей Железнев  
Необходимо разработать сервис по работе с задачами. Дизайн и верстка (html+css) уже есть и теперь нужно только скриптовая часть на PHP (БД Mysql).

Функции:
- Регистрация клиента. Указываемые данные: логин, e-mail, пароль, мобильный телефон. Логин должен быть уникальным. На один e-mail нельзя зарегистрировать более одного акка. Пароль должен быть не менее 8 символов, но не более 30. Мобильный телефон должен проверяться на валидность. После регистрации на почту высылается письмо с ссылкой на активацию акка. Ссылка действует только 3 суток. Регистрация должна быть защищена капчей.
- Напоминание пароля. Можно сгенерировать новый пароль и выслать его на почту, указанную при регистрации, при вводе логина и той самой почты. Для одного акка нельзя восстановить пароль чаще трех раз в день.
- Профиль клиента. У каждого клиента есть профиль, в котором он может менять регистрационные данные и аватар с фото. Аватар и фото можно закачать в png, jpg и gif. Максимальный размер файла и его размеры по ширине и вышине в пикселях должны задаваться в админке. Кроме этого можно указывать icq, логины в однокласниках и вконтакте. У каждого клиента есть баланс в рублях.
- Задачи. Каждый клиент можно создать новую задачу. Задача состоит из заголовка, описания и файлов к ней. Описание должно поддерживать удобное визуальное форматирование, т.е. это когда не теги всякие используются а именно как в ворде и тому подобное.
-- Задачу можно сделать приватной, т.е. доступной только самому клиенту, или публичной, т.е. доступной всем клиентам сайта.
-- Любой из клиентов сайта может закрепить за собой выполнение публичной задачи, но для этого нужно спросить разрешение у постановщика задачи, т.е. при закреплении должно выводится поле в котором описывается почему именно ему должна отдаваться задача. Все эти сообщения поступают постановщику и уже он решает кому отдать задачу.
-- Клиенты могут оценивать публичную задачу от 1 до 10 балов. За возможность постановки 10 баллов снимается 1 рубль, но это должно меняться в админской части.
-- Постановщик задачи может назначать цену за выполнение задачи. Если он принимает выполнение задачи, то цена переводится со счета постановщика на счет исполнителя. При постановке задачи стоимость задачи блокируется на счете постановщика, чтобы исключить перерасход.
- Администратор может делать с задачами и клиентами все.
- К сайту нужно подключить WebMoney и QIWI.
- Все операции пополнения, внутренних переводов и вывода должны сохраняться.

Сколько будет стоить создание подобного проекта?
Есть ли предоплата? Сколько по срокам будет это?
Разделы:
Опубликован:
26.09.2010 | 19:45

Теги: нужен программист, резюме программиста, требуется программист, резюме веб программиста

Наши партнеры
Сведения об ООО «Ваан» внесены в реестр аккредитованных организаций, осуществляющих деятельность в области информационных технологий. ООО «Ваан» осуществляет деятельность, связанную с использованием информационных технологий, по разработке компьютерного программного обеспечения, предоставлению доступа к программе для ЭВМ и является правообладателем программы для ЭВМ «Платформа FL.ru (версия 2.0)».